h1. 現象
為一個dubbbo介面新增了一個方法:
{code}DomainObject<String> testSer();實現:@Override public DomainObject<String> testSer() { DomainObject<String> result = new DomainObject<String>(); result.setAge(10); result.setName("test"); result.add("DomainObject1"); return result; }{code}
傳回值定義如下:
{code}public class DomainObject<E> extends ArrayList<E> { private static final long serialVersionUID = -7393642276493435828L; private String name; private int age;}{code}
遠程調用:
{code}DomainObject<String> result = voucherInfoQueryService.testSer();System.out.println(result.getAge());System.out.println(result.getName());System.out.println(result.get(0));{code}
輸出結果:丟失了age和name兩個屬性的值,而 list內部的值還是存在的
{code}0nullDomainObject1{code}h1. 問題排查h4. 使用java內建序列化執行序列化和還原序列化, 不會出現屬性丟失的問題,懷疑dubbo序列化有特殊處理h4. dubbo 預設用的序列化協議是hessian2,查看代碼
序列化時代碼如下:
{code}public void writeObject(Object object) throws IOException { if (object == null) { writeNull(); return; } Serializer serializer; ##尋找對應的serializer serializer = findSerializerFactory().getSerializer(object.getClass()); ##序列化 serializer.writeObject(object, this); }{code}
尋找serializer:由代碼可知,上面的DomainObject對應的serializer是CollectionSerializer
{code}public Serializer getSerializer(Class cl) throws HessianProtocolException { ... else if (Collection.class.isAssignableFrom(cl)) { if (_collectionSerializer == null) {_collectionSerializer = new CollectionSerializer(); ... }{code}
CollectionSerializer.writeObject
{code}public void writeObject(Object obj, AbstractHessianOutput out) throws IOException { ... Iterator iter = list.iterator(); while (iter.hasNext()) { Object value = iter.next(); out.writeObject(value); } ... }{code}
所以,屬性丟失。
